Mariella Frostrup investigates publishing houses, and how they work with authors to nurture and develop their talent. She talks to veteran publisher Anthony Cheetham, Stephen Page of Faber and authors including Tracy Chevalier and Rose Tremain. In this special programme Mariella uncovers the secrets of tactful and helpful editing and finds out why Quarantine author Jim Crace thinks writers should be more cheerful.
